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b fresh carrots
- 2 tbsp unsalted butter
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 tbsp fresh thyme or parsley
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Wash and peel the carrots, then cut them into uniform chunks.
- Boil the carrot pieces in salted water for 15-20 minutes until fork-tender.
- Drain the carrots and return them to the pot. Smash gently using a potato masher or fork.
- In a small saucepan, melt butter and olive oil over low heat. Add minced garlic; s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
- Pour the butter mixture over the smashed carrots, mixing well. Season with salt, pepper, and fresh herbs before serving.
